2026 Innovate! Celebrate! Student Award Winners
The student awards segment of the annual Innovate! Celebrate! Entrepreneurship event underscored the breadth of Lehigh's entrepreneurship reach, from early-stage social impact projects headed to Sierra Leone this summer, to a clinically validated pediatric health venture, to a card game that has already cleared six figures in sales.
- Davis Projects for Peace Prize, presented by Bill Whitney
- CareAlert: Timely Alerts, Better Care: Lilian Wu, Marianna Angle, Regina Ruiz, Kavya Famolari, Olivia Meyer, María García Rodriguez, Nova Afber, Claire Schwartz, Olivia Dubrow
- Newtrition: Samantha Sandhaus, Sophia Principe, Alyssa Rokhvarg, Marloe Laughlin
- R.K. Laros Foundation Endowed Prize for Entrepreneurship, Creativity & Innovation: Tawheeda Huq ’27; Connor Keene ’26
- Daniel Katz ’23P Family Endowment Fund for Entrepreneurship: Canaan Kimball ’26
- Joan F. & John M. Thalheimer ’55 Student Venture Award: JR Perez ’27
- Donald E. Flinchbaugh Memorial Endowed Scholarship: Max Russo ’28
- Michael W. Levin Advanced Technology Competition: Walker Blair ’27 & Logan Galletta ’27
